Investing in a water softener system can greatly enhance your quality of life by addressing the challenges posed by hard water. Not only does it protect your home and appliances, but it also improves your daily tasks and personal care routines. As water quality continues to be a concern in many areas, understanding and utilizing water softener systems can provide an effective solution for a healthier home and lifestyle.

Installation of Fibergrate stair treads is straightforward, enabling rapid deployment in various settings. They can be installed over existing stairs or as part of new constructions. The non-corrosive nature of FRP means that the installation does not require complicated coatings or treatments that are often necessary with other materials. This ease of installation combined with low maintenance requirements makes Fibergrate an attractive option for many construction projects.

In commercial spaces, floor steel grating can contribute to a modern and industrial aesthetic. Restaurants and cafes often use steel grating as part of their flooring, creating an appealing design while ensuring safety and durability. Furthermore, it can be effectively used in outdoor settings, including parks and public plazas, where drainage and slip resistance are critical.
